Question 881141: a truck contained 35 boxes, some weighing 6 pounds and the rest weighing 10 pounds. if the total weight of the boxes was 262 pounds, find the number of each type of box in the truck

x = number of 6 pound boxes
35 - x = number of 10 pound boxes {there are 35 boxes}

6x + 10(35 - x) = 262 {weight of each box multiplied by number of boxes equals total weight}
6x + 350 - 10x = 262 {used distributive property}
-4x + 350 = 262 {combined like terms}
-4x = -88 {subtracted 350 from each side}
x = 22 {divided each side by -4}
35 - x = 13 {substituted 22, in for x, into 35 - x}

22 six pound boxes
13 ten pound boxes
